Francine Griffin: The Song Bird

Read "The Song Bird" reviewed by Jack Bowers


Delmark Records waited 45 years to release its first vocal Jazz album. The singer who persuaded them to do so is Francine Griffin, a senior citizen from Cincinnati who proves on Song Bird that Delmark’s decision has considerable merit.
